About Alicia Carol Bianco

Alicia is a dedicated associate personal injury attorney with Marasco & Nesselbush, having a passion for advocating on behalf of individuals who have suffered personal injuries or medical malpractice. A magna cum laude graduate of Roger Williams University School of Law in 2015, Alicia ranked 14th in her class and began her legal career with a steadfast commitment to helping those in need.

During law school, Alicia gained invaluable experience working with a prominent plaintiff’s medical malpractice firm in Rhode Island. It was there that she witnessed the transformative impact a skilled and compassionate attorney can have on clients during some of the most challenging moments of their lives.

Following graduation, Alicia was honored to clerk for the Rhode Island Supreme Court clerk pool, where she refined her legal skills and developed a deep understanding of complex legal issues. She then joined a medical malpractice defense firm, representing hospitals and physicians. This experience provided Alicia with a comprehensive understanding of how these cases are defended, allowing her to bring a unique perspective to her work as a plaintiff’s attorney.

In addition to her litigation experience, Alicia spent five years practicing real estate and business law, helping clients in Massachusetts, Rhode Island, and Connecticut achieve their goals and secure their futures. While she valued the opportunity to guide clients through important milestones, Alicia’s passion for making a tangible difference in the lives of those affected by negligence ultimately brought her back to personal injury and medical malpractice litigation.

At Marasco & Nesselbush, Alicia is committed to standing by her clients during their most vulnerable times, offering not only legal expertise but also empathy and understanding. She takes pride in helping clients navigate the legal process, ensuring they feel supported and empowered as they seek justice and the best possible outcomes for themselves and their families.
